The use of alien gene transfers

The present status of the gene transfers from alien species belonging to the sub-tribe Triticanae into wheat is reviewed, and the advantages and disadvantages of the different methods available for such transfers are examined. In general, the alien genes provide a high degree of resistance against a notably wide range of physiological races of wheat rusts, powdery mildew and other diseases. The alien resistance, like other sources of resistance, is known to break down for certain new races. This may happen more often when alien genes of resistance are widely incorporated in commercial cultivars and grown over large areas. So far, few of the available induced translocation stocks have contributed to the development of agronomically superior commercial cultivars, mainly due to the associated undesirable effects of the translocations on agronomic characters of the recipient variety. The deleterious effects appear in some genetic backgrounds and not in others. Extensive hybridization of translocation stocks with different genotypes has been emphasized by most investigators. Such programmes have led to the release of three commercial cultivars - 2 in Australia and 1 in the USA. On the other hand, spontaneous wheat-rye translocations carrying gene(s) for disease resistance have been unconsciously incorporated into several wheat cultivars, some of them are widely cultivated and were top in ranking based on grain yield.
